Selected Responsibilities: 

  • Accurate and timely input of orders into the warehouse management system
  • Provide order acknowledgements to clients and/or dealers and sales team
  • Handle inquiries by phone, fax, e-mail, and personal visits
  • Collaborate with internal departments to resolve customer questions and/or concerns
  • Communicate with operations and/or logistics to resolve sales and production issues and provide support on open orders
  • Analyze transactions, correct records, and adjust errors
  • Process requests for brochures, samples, and price quotations
  • Assist in returns and replacements as needed
  • Work directly with external sales team and provide support and information as needed
